A rapid spike in cases of a potentially deadly, drug-resistant fungus has concerned public health officials across the nation. But a team of Southern Nevada researchers hope their new study applying wastewater surveillance can help health officials get a step ahead of this emerging global public health threat. The Pathogen Problem Candida auris is a fungus that can cause serious infections, particularly in patients who are immunocompromised, have pre-existing health conditions, are in long-term healthcare settings, or are undergoing treatment with invasive medical devices such as a catheter. Credit: Unsplash/CC0 Public Domain Australians generated at least $287.86 billion in value through unpaid social contributions in 2021, according to a new report from the University of Sydney’s Mental Wealth Initiative. The report, “A Contributing Life: A Snapshot of the Value of Social Production,” shines a spotlight on the unseen value Australians contribute to national prosperity in terms of social production—value that traditionally lies outside of the boundary of gross domestic product (GDP). Intense emotions are correlated with a change in our stomach’s pHGrace Cary/Moment RF/Getty Images Having a “gut feeling” about something may not just be a metaphor. New research suggests that feeling intense emotions is accompanied by changes to our stomach’s pH. Giuseppina Porciello at the Sapienza University of Rome and her colleagues asked 31 men with an average age of 24 to swallow a commercially available smart pill that measures pH, temperature and pressure in the gut. Evie Junior’s life has been defined by pain. He was born with sickle cell disease, which causes red blood cells to be sticky and C-shaped, not smooth and round. These cells are supposed to move freely through blood vessels, carrying oxygen to the body. But in people with this inherited form of anemia, they clump together and block blood flow. This triggers excruciating episodes known as pain crises, which can happen anywhere in the body and last for hours or even weeks.
